Docker’da Unable to Configure HTTPS Endpoint Hatası
Herkese merhaba,
Bu yazıda Docker’da Unable to configure HTTPS endpoint. No server certificate was specified, and the default developer certificate could not be found or is out of date hatasının nasıl çözülebileceğinden bahsedeceğim.
Bu hata ile ASP.NET Core’da .Net Framework 6.0 geliştirirken Docker Microservice mimarisini ayağa kaldırırken karşılaştım.
Hatanın çözümü aşağıdaki gibidir.
Docker’da Https dinlemeyi devre dışı bırakmak için ‘docker-compose.override.yml’ veya ‘docker-compose.yml’ dosyasındaki aşağıdaki koddan 443 bağlantı noktasını kaldırmanız yeterlidir.
Aşağıdaki Kodu
- ASPNETCORE_URLS=https://+:443;http://+:80
Bu kod ile değiştirin.
- ASPNETCORE_URLS=http://+:80
Demek istediğim kısmı fotoğrafta gösterirsem aşağıdaki kısımdır.
Dediğim düzeltmeyi yaparsanız büyük ihtimalle projeniz ayağa kalkacaktır.
Herkese çalışma hayatında ve yaşamında başarılar kolaylıklar.